We are looking for a Digital Marketing Associate (Apprentice) to join our Global Marketing Communications team. You will receive first-class, on-the-job training from a dedicated team, whilst earning a competitive salary, not to mention an industry-recognised qualification too.
Course Information
- Course: Marketing executive (level 4)
- Level: 4
- Route: Sales, marketing and procurement
- Apprenticeship Level: Higher
Working Arrangements
- Working Week: Monday - Friday 8:30am - 4:30pm
- Expected Duration: 2 Years
This employer is part of the Disability Confident scheme, committed to employing disabled people.

How to prepare for a job interview at Victrex Manufacturing Limited
✨Know Your Digital Marketing Basics
Before the interview, brush up on key digital marketing concepts like SEO, PPC, and social media strategies. This will show your potential employer that you're genuinely interested in the field and ready to learn.
✨Showcase Your Creativity
Prepare to discuss any creative projects or campaigns you've worked on, even if they were for school or personal use. Employers love seeing innovative thinking, so bring examples that highlight your unique approach to marketing challenges.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Come prepared with questions about the company's marketing strategies or recent campaigns. This not only demonstrates your enthusiasm but also gives you a chance to engage in a meaningful conversation during the interview.
✨Highlight Your Willingness to Learn
Since this is an apprenticeship, emphasise your eagerness to learn and grow within the role. Share specific examples of how you've adapted to new challenges in the past, showing that you're ready to take on this opportunity with both hands.
